Laburnham Road is in North Walsham and in North Norfolk district. NR28 0EL is located in the North Walsham West electoral ward, within the English Parliamentary constituency of North Norfolk. This postcode has been in use since 1980-01-01.

In the UK, the overall gender distribution is approximately 49% male and 51% female. The area surrounding NR28 0EL has a slightly higher male population, with 51.5% of residents being male. Several factors can contribute to this, including areas with industries or sectors that predominantly employ men, proximity to universities or technical schools with a higher enrollment of male students, presence of all-male or predominantly male institutions (military academies, boarding schools).
| 2011 | 2021 | 10y change (pp) | UK Average | postcode vs UK (pp) | |
|---|---|---|---|---|---|
| Female | 55.4% | 48.5% | -6.9% | 51.0% | -2.5% |
| Male | 44.6% | 51.5% | 6.9% | 49.0% | 2.5% |

Across the UK, the average 48.4% rated their health as Very Good, 33.6% as Good, 12.7% as Fair, 4% as Bad, and 1.2% as Very Bad.
Population age significantly impacts residents' health. Additionally, socioeconomic status plays a crucial role: higher income levels and lower poverty rates are linked to better health outcomes. Affluent areas benefit from higher living standards, access to private healthcare, and healthier lifestyle choices.
This area has a lower percentage of residents reporting their health as Good or Very Good (69.3%) compared to the average (82%). This typically indicates either an older population or social deprivation in the area.
| 2011 | 2021 | 10y change (pp) | UK Average | postcode vs UK (pp) | |
|---|---|---|---|---|---|
| Very good health | 37.5% | 29.3% | -8.2% | 48.4% | -19.1% |
| Good health | 38.1% | 40% | 1.9% | 33.6% | 6.4% |
| Fair health | 17.6% | 22.7% | 5.1% | 12.7% | 10.0% |
| Bad health | 6.2% | 6.3% | 0.1% | 4.0% | 2.3% |
| Very bad health | 0.7% | 1.7% | 1.0% | 1.2% | 0.5% |
During the 2021 census, the educational qualifications of residents across the UK were as follows: 18.2% had no qualifications, 9.6% had 1-4 GCSEs, 13.4% had 5 or more GCSEs and 1-2 A/AS Levels, 16.9% had 2 or more A Levels, 33.8% held a degree (or equivalent), and 5.4% had completed an apprenticeship.
In the area around NR28 0EL this area, 30% of residents have no qualifications. This is significantly higher than the UK average of 18.2%. This area stands out for its low percentage of residents with higher education degree. The UK average is 33.8%, while in this area it is 14.2%.
| 2011 | 2021 | 10y change (pp) | UK Average | postcode vs UK (pp) | |
|---|---|---|---|---|---|
| No qualifications | 39% | 30% | -9.0% | 18.2% | 11.8% |
| 1-4 GCSEs or Equivalent | 11.9% | 14.2% | 2.3% | 9.6% | 4.6% |
| 5 or more GCSEs, an A-Level or 1-2 AS Levels | 19.9% | 17.8% | -2.1% | 13.4% | 4.4% |
| Apprenticeship | 4.2% | 8.1% | 3.9% | 5.3% | 2.8% |
| HNC, HND or 2+ A Levels | 11.9% | 13.8% | 1.9% | 16.9% | -3.1% |
| Degree or Similar | 9.7% | 14.2% | 4.5% | 33.8% | -19.6% |
| Other | 3.4% | 2% | -1.4% | 2.8% | -0.8% |

Over the last 12 months, the overall crime rate around Laburnham Road was 43.2 per 1,000 residents, which is 32.9% lower than the North Walsham Market Cross average. The most reported crime type was Violence and sexual offences.
Laburnham Road has the 9th highest crime rate of 20 local areas in North Walsham Market Cross and the 136th highest crime rate of 373 local areas in North Norfolk .
Violent and sexual offences accounted for around 27.8 crimes per 1,000 residents and have been falling year on year. Over the last decade, overall crime has fallen by about -16.9%.
